What Is a Bitcoin Stock Chart?

A Bitcoin stock chart visually represents the historical price movements of Bitcoin over different timeframes. These charts help traders and investors analyze patterns, trends, and potential breakout points. Unlike traditional stocks, Bitcoin operates in a decentralized market, making its price highly volatile.

How to Read a Bitcoin Stock Chart

A Bitcoin stock chart includes several components that traders use to interpret market behavior:

  • Timeframes: Bitcoin charts can be viewed in various timeframes, such as 1-minute, 5-minute, hourly, daily, and weekly.
  • Price Action: Identifying bullish and bearish trends through candlestick formations.
  • Volume: Higher volume indicates strong market participation and trend validation.
  • Technical Indicators: Moving averages, RSI, MACD, and Bollinger Bands assist in trend and momentum analysis.

Factors Influencing Bitcoin Prices

Several factors drive Bitcoin’s price fluctuations, including:

  1. Market Demand and Supply – Bitcoin’s fixed supply of 21 million coins impacts its scarcity and value.
  2. Institutional Adoption – Increased participation from institutional investors influences price movements.
  3. Regulatory Developments – Government policies and regulations impact Bitcoin’s accessibility and use.
  4. Macroeconomic Events – Inflation, interest rates, and global financial crises affect investor sentiment.
  5. Halving Events – Bitcoin undergoes a halving every four years, reducing mining rewards and influencing price trends.

Technical Analysis for Bitcoin Stock Charts

1. Support and Resistance Levels

  • Support represents a price level where buying interest is strong enough to prevent further decline.
  • Resistance is a price level where selling pressure limits further upward movement.

2. Moving Averages and Trend Lines

  • Moving Averages (e.g., 50-day, 200-day) help smooth price action and confirm trends.
  • Trend lines indicate market direction and potential breakout points.

3. Candlestick Patterns

  • Bullish Patterns: Hammer, bullish engulfing, morning star.
  • Bearish Patterns: Shooting star, bearish engulfing, evening star.

Trading Strategies for Bitcoin

  1. Breakout Trading: Enter positions when price breaks above resistance or below support with volume confirmation.
  2. Trend Following: Use moving averages and momentum indicators to confirm market trends.
  3. Scalping: Execute short-term trades based on small price movements.
  4. Swing Trading: Hold positions for several days or weeks to capture medium-term trends.
  5. Risk Management: Use stop-loss orders and proper position sizing to minimize potential losses.
